Path of Exile 2: All Anomaly Bosses and How to Clear Them

Anomaly bosses in Path of Exile 2 have quickly become some of the most challenging and rewarding encounters in the game. Introduced in patch 0.3, these bosses drop exclusive Lineage Support Gems that are highly sought after for endgame builds. As of now, there are four Anomaly bosses, all tied to final encounters from Act 4 and the three Interludes. All Anomaly Bosses in Path of Exile 2

 

1) Manoki, the Chosen

 

·Location: Jade Isle (Endgame Atlas)

·Inspired by: Tavakai, Karui Chieftain (Act 4)

·Access Requirements: Remove Maelstrom by clearing connected maps and disabling a Karui Beacon.

 

Manoki is a three-phase encounter:

 

·Phase One: Manoki appears in semi-human form. Reduce his HP by 60% to trigger a transformation, and HP reset near Tukohama's shrine. Watch for slam attacks.

·Phase Two: The boss uses corrupted attacks and spikes from the ground. A short delay allows dodging, but hitting full damage quickly is essential.

·Phase Three: Increased speed and AoE attacks. Prolonged fights risk a DoT ground attack that drains life flasks.

 

Possible Rewards: Kaom's Madness, Rakiata's Flow, Tawhoa's Tending, Tasalio's Rhythm.

 

Tips: Maintain mobility, use ranged or dodging skills to avoid spikes, and burst him down before the arena becomes overwhelming.

 

2) Varloch, the Ashen Lord, and Avelyne, the Withered Rose

 

·Location: Derelict Mansion (Atlas Node)

·Inspired by: Interlude 1 - Curse of Holten

·Access Requirements: Activate Draiocht Hengestones in connected maps.

 

This fight is dual-boss combat:

 

·Varloch: Uses sword slams and shockwaves; timing and positioning are key.

·Avelyne: Summons Bone Cages and orbital strikes. Break cages quickly and avoid AoE damage.

 

Possible Rewards: Rigwald's Ferocity, Ailith's Chimes, Einhar's Beastrite.

3) Zahmir, the Blade Sovereign

 

·Location: Sacred Reservoir (Atlas Node)

·Inspired by: Azmadi, Faridun Prince (Interlude 2)

·Access Requirements: Disable three Temporal Tethers across connected desert maps.

 

Two-Phase Fight:

 

·Phase One: Zahmir's attacks come in combos and can stagger your character. Lower HP by 40% before he enters phase two.

·Phase Two: Supercharged with additional combos and time-related attacks. Curving attacks make dodging tricky; do not let him move off-screen.

 

Possible Rewards: Varashta's Blessing, Khatal's Rejuvenation, Zarokh's Refrain, Garukhan's Resolve.

 

Tips: Focus on mobility and dodging combos. Use terrain or obstacles to reduce exposure and prepare for sudden supercharged attacks.

 

4) Ytzara, Blood Oracle, and Maztli, Flesh-Shaper

 

·Location: Estazunti's Vault (Atlas Node)

·Inspired by: Interlude 3 - Vaal sibling duo

·Access Requirements: Spawn via floating pillar after defeating the connected map boss (patch 0.4 update).

 

Fight Mechanics:

 

·Claw Attack: Leech life from the sister; dodge carefully.

·Corrupted Beam: Brother performs a laser attack; avoid it using cover or distance.

·Goliath Slam: Brother transforms and performs AoE slam; maintain safe distance.

·Possible Rewards: Atalui's Bloodletting, Tacati's Ire, Paquate's Pact.

 

Tips: Focus on one boss at a time if possible. Avoid prolonged exposure to leech attacks, and ensure your team manages positioning to mitigate AoE damage.

 

General Strategies for Anomaly Bosses

 

1. Use Precursor Tablets to empower bosses for higher loot quality.

2. Tier 15 Waystones increase item rarity and drop chance.

3. Avoid dying: Losing all revives results in loss of map rewards.

4. Coordinate crowd control and positioning: Especially critical for dual-boss fights like Varloch and Avelyne.

5. Understand attack patterns: All Anomaly bosses have predictable yet deadly attacks that can be exploited with careful timing.
